Looks like it retains the reverse lockout feature and for $80 you do not get a new shift knob.

Also, you can disable the reverse lockout feature very easily if you would like to go with a different knob. One that uses set screws to attach it to the shift lever.

I bought the obx shifter i loved how it shifted very short throw.was very easy to install.But I had it on my car for 3 days and i was driving to work and stoped at a red light put the car in neutral.When i went to put it 1st it felt like the cable broke.Pulled the shifter boot up and the weld on the cable ball broke.Still trying to get ahold of obx to replace it.
